How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Eastern 49 63?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Eastern 49 63 Studio Apartments | $1,170 | $845 | $1,835 |
| Eastern 49 63 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,625 | $795 | $2,629 |
| Eastern 49 63 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,959 | $915 | $4,030 |
| Eastern 49 63 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,121 | $1,100 | $3,500 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Eastern 49 63?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,307 | $875 | $2,450 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,611 | $995 | $3,500 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$1,839 | $1,395 | $2,895 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$1,900 | $1,900 | $1,900 |
